This exceptional 2,126 square-foot executive office suite is ideally situated in a renovated building at 2500 NW 107th Ave #200. The single-tenant space boasts a highly functional layout, perfect for a variety of professional uses. Featuring approximately six private offices, a well-appointed kitchenette, a dedicated reception area, and an open workspace, this suite offers ample room for both individual work and collaborative efforts. The building benefits from excellent visibility and convenient parking. The space is currently configured as a doctor's office, showcasing its adaptability and suitability for medical practices or other professional businesses. This turnkey solution is available for lease beginning March 2025. The advertised rate of approximately $13.00 per square foot includes operating expenses. Additionally, there is a separate annual charge of approximately $28.00 per square foot. The property is zoned 7600 and its Assessor's Parcel Number (APN) is 35-30-30-034-0030.
